encanar

Meaning

  1. (transitive) to conduct (liquid) through a tube, canal or aqueduct; to pipe
  2. (transitive) to cut grooves in (a column) lengthwise
  3. (transitive) to orient in a given direction
  4. (Portugal, colloquial, transitive) to drink (too much wine)

Opposite of
desencanar
Pronounced as (IPA)
/ẽ.kaˈna(ʁ)/
Etymology

From en- + cano + -ar.
